[edit] Etymology
Composition of streymur (stream) and oy (island) = "Stream Island", due to the currents in the sound between Streymoy and Eysturoy
[edit] Pronunciation
- IPA: [ˈstrɛimɔi], [ˈstrɛimi]
[edit] Proper noun
Streymoy f.
- The biggest of the Faroe Islands
